Output 18f8cd6831b088a343e00dbc1f4c5cbb7e193c315bb97ff2be9f20e2a649c6f2:0

value
366304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a646cdfe7478a1cd0e36bd17c686f9518d57591 OP_EQUAL
address
32dxz8hp1qXn4pEjBkANhf1ruHeHoZvxy8
transaction
18f8cd6831b088a343e00dbc1f4c5cbb7e193c315bb97ff2be9f20e2a649c6f2
spent
true